Answer with explanation:

\bar{AB}\cong\bar{CD}

                                     ---------------------[Given]

\bar{AB}=\bar{CD}

                                   -----------------[By definition of congruent segments]---(2)

Also, AB= AE + EB

CD= CF +FD

Substituting the value of , AB and CD in equation (2),which reduces to

A E + E B=CF +FD

Also, \bar{CF}=\bar{EB}

CF=E B--------[By definition of congruent segments]

A E + E B=FD +E B→→[Substitution Property]

Subtracting EB , from both sides

AE +EB - EB = FD + EB - EB

Which gives, A E = F D→→→→[Subtraction Property of Equality]

\bar{AE}\cong\bar{FD}

→→→The Missing reason in the proof is :

Option(D.): Subtraction Property of Equality
